Otherwise.....take only salads (a bowlfull of lettuce/cucumber/carrot/aspargus) in place of your regular launch........around evening take a bowl of soup......any flavour of your choice, we used Knor soup and it has just 90 Cal per serving.....so, you can have two bowls of soup every day......
Decrease your salt intake (1500mg-2000 mg is recommended per day), but please make it even low. The salt used to retain more water in your body and sometimes shows higher scale....
Avoid taking empty calories in any form like brownies/pastries etc........even high salt snacks are bad like Pritzels.....
Rather try to take plain crackers (without any toppings of cheese) in between when you feel hungry.......it will help you reduce your hunger.........

More of salads and fruits, avoid rice to the maximum.
Eat Brown bread.

Avoid White Flour (Maida), Coconut and deep fried items.

Stop eating munchings, instead opt for fruits and green salads, sprouted dals and lots of curd.

Intake of liquid is a must. Drink skimmed milk every day. Also have more of juice (sans sugar).

Have warm water mixed with honey and lime early in the morning.

These are the basic tips. Being Southy, avoiding rice and coconut is difficult. Isn't it! Atleast for me.

Go for your walks everyday.
